forked from len0rd/rockbox
Sansa e200v2: bootloader: fit size
Max allowed size: 120860 Old thumb build: 128494 New thumb build: 118514 (fits!) Disabled: Logo; alpha blending capabilities for bitmaps; Arm stack unwinder (backtrace); Related forum discussion: https://forums.rockbox.org/index.php/topic,54768.0.html Fixes FS#12380 Change-Id: I978720d795cb0ef5169103e467cf8386c21d8e93
This commit is contained in:
parent
2570909e52
commit
c36d7768c5
13 changed files with 41 additions and 11 deletions
|
|
@ -145,11 +145,15 @@ void NORETURN_ATTR UIE(unsigned int pc, unsigned int num)
|
|||
} /* num == 1 || num == 2 // prefetch/data abort */
|
||||
#endif /* !defined(CPU_ARM7TDMI */
|
||||
|
||||
#ifdef HAVE_RB_BACKTRACE
|
||||
if (!triggered)
|
||||
{
|
||||
triggered = true;
|
||||
rb_backtrace(pc, __get_sp(), &line);
|
||||
}
|
||||
#else
|
||||
(void)triggered;
|
||||
#endif
|
||||
|
||||
lcd_update();
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ue